Introducing Wabber
The latest addition to the Wonkie family is a comical site called Wabber - Avoid Work. Wabber is short for a person who indulges in WAB - Work Avoidance Behaviour. There will be a collection of funny stuff being put up on the site - from photo captions contests to the best from other cartoon sites and general internet fun content that is currently doing its rounds through the email networks.
Wabber will also contain a number of cartoon strips including ze Guru (covering spiritual and relgious humor), Stat (a medical related strip), and casino pigs (a gambling related cartoon strip).
